An award-winning celebrity chef and TV personality\, she is redefining modern food culture with her allergy-friendly\, health-forward approach\, building a community of over 1.3+ million Food Baes. \nFollowing October 7\, Brooke spent significant time in Israel volunteering with the Israel Defense Forces\, the Asif Culinary Institute\, and Shuva Achim\, using food as a tool for support and solidarity. Beyond the kitchen\, she leads a nonprofit cooking program in Los Angeles and New York that teaches families on food stamps how to prepare nourishing meals on a budget. In 2025\, she raised $260\,000 and led Los Angeles’ largest wildfire relief meal effort\, feeding thousands of frontline responders and displaced families. \nBrooke is the expert talent behind many recipe developments\, as well as innovations for Nestlé\, Panera Bread\, Purely Elizabeth\, and Freshly. Featured on Food Network\, NBC\, ABC News\, Forbes\, The Kelly Clarkson Show\, and as the previous host of Overheard Eats\, Chef Bae has become a recognizable face in the culinary world. Beyond recipe creation and TV appearances\, Chef Bae has launched her own highly successful food partnerships\, including limited-edition items with Erewhon Market\, Monty’s\, Sauce Bae\, Fermentation Farm\, and Vibe Kitchen—many of which sold out upon release and became menu staples. As a private chef\, she has cooked for Mindy Kaling\, Kevin Hart\, Paris Hilton\, the Sandlers\, the Duchess of Essex\, Kathy Hilton\, and many more. DESCRIPTION:Honoring the legacy of Donald Love\, z”l\, the Jewish Federation of Southern New Jersey established the Love Impact Awards to celebrate those in our community who follow in Don’s footsteps of volunteer work. Don was an innovator and always looked at how programs could make an impact in our community. The Love Impact Awards will honor local volunteers whose meaningful service has made a lasting difference in Southern New Jersey\, just as Don’s lifetime of dedication and volunteerism did. \nThe Love Impact Awards celebrates award recipients across our Five Areas of Impact – Older Adults\, Disability Services\, Global Connections\, Community Engagement\, and Family & Youth. These Areas of Impact and their related programs and services offer comprehensive support to all ages and to the diverse needs and interests of our community.
